I've been on keto for 6 months and lost 30 lb. I eat the Same meals I ate before minus the starch. So if supper was chicken, rice and vegetables, I eat the chicken and veg but not the rice. I do have a vegetarian cookbook I use to find interesting veg recipes but even that depends on my energy level. Plain stir fried or baked vegs works for me.

What exactly are you looking for
Baked goods, mains, side dishes?
Almost anything can have a kosher substitute, or be left out.
Heavy Cream can be substituted with full fat coconut cream
Facon can substitute bacon.
I’ve made crispy chicken skin to substitute pork rinds
I use chicken fat instead of lard

I am on keto and have some wonderful recipes. One is for zucchini bites, and they are really simple.

Preheat oven to 400 degrees

Shred 2 zucchinis in a food processor. Squeeze the liquid out before going on. Add 1 egg for each cup of zucchini. Add 1/3 cup hemp seed for each cup of zucchini. Add the following spices for each cup of zucchini:
2 tablespoons parsley
1 tablespoon basil
1 tablespoon oregano
1clove garlic minced
Salt and pepper to taste

Line a cookie sheet with parchment paper and spray with olive oil. Roll balls of the mixture. From 4 cups of zucchini you should get about 25 balls. Place on cookie sheet and lightly spray them with olive oil. Bake until golden on top. These freeze very well.

If you need a YT treat, make this pound cake.

Preheat oven to 375.

6 eggs
1/3 cup olive oil
1/3 cup coconut milk

Place these ingredients into a food processor and just let them mix while you prepare everything else.

In a two cup measure place:
1 cup coconut flour
2 tablespoons stevia
1 teaspoon xanthan gum
1 tablespoon baking powder
1/2 teaspoon vanilla
1 tablespoon cardamom
1 teaspoon cinnamon
Either the zest of 1orange or the juice from 2 orange sections

Dump this.into your egg mixture and keep mixing. Line a loaf pan with parchment paper. Pour in mixture and smooth the top. Bake for about 45-50 minutes. Let cool completely before slicing I to 10 slices.
